使用 queue-watch 自动重启 Laravel 队列工作进程
💡
原文英文,约700词,阅读约需3分钟。
📝
内容提要
这篇文章介绍了一个用于自动重启 Laravel 应用程序中队列工作进程的包。该包会监测 Laravel 应用程序的 jobs、events 和 listeners 文件夹中的文件变化,并在检测到变化时自动重启队列工作进程。这样可以确保工作进程始终使用最新的代码,减少手动重启的负担,提高效率。
🎯
关键要点
- 文章介绍了一个用于自动重启 Laravel 应用程序中队列工作进程的包。
- 该包监测 Laravel 应用程序的 jobs、events 和 listeners 文件夹中的文件变化。
- 检测到变化时,包会自动重启队列工作进程,确保使用最新代码。
- 手动重启工作进程效率低下,可能导致应用不一致或过时的队列处理。
- 包的工作原理包括监测特定文件夹、检测变化和重启队列工作进程。
- 安装包的步骤简单,通过 Composer 安装并发布配置文件。
- 可以自定义监测的文件夹和排除某些文件。
- 包安装后自动在后台运行,无需手动操作。
- 自动重启队列工作进程提高了效率,减少了错误,确保开发流程顺畅。
- 该包适合希望简化开发和部署流程的 Laravel 用户。
🏷️
标签
➡️